GTA Online’s Sluggish PC Loading Times Has Been fixed Thanks To A Fan

Shimni Mim
Shimni Mim
Published on March 16, 2021
Share
2 Min Read
SHARE

GitHub user t0st discovered a six-year-old CPU bottleneck in the game’s code.

Rockstar Games will before long address GTA Online’s notorious PC loading times. The fix comes almost six years after the game came out on Windows. Furthermore, PC players may have wound up standing by much more, notwithstanding being crafted by somebody locally.

As PC Gamer recounts the story, an individual who goes by the handle of t0st as of late took to GitHub to share proof of concept of a fix they produced for the game. They guaranteed it could improve GTA Online’s stacking times by as much as 70% by addressing an issue with a CPU bottleneck. They cautioned the fix wasn’t “for easygoing use,” yet assessed a solitary developer at Rockstar could execute something comparable in under a day.

Everything considered, it will take longer than that, yet as indicated by Rockstar, an authority fix is in transit. “After a thorough investigation, we can confirm that player t0st did reveal an aspect of the game code related to load times for the PC version of GTA Online that could be improved,” the company told PC Gamer. “As a result of these investigations, we have made some changes that will be implemented in a forthcoming title update.”

Rockstar didn’t say when it intends to deliver the fix. Yet, following quite a while of enduring sluggish loading times, in any event, there’s a promising end to current circumstances for PC players.
